TypeBuilder.GetCustomAttributes Método

Definição

Devolve os atributos personalizados definidos para este tipo.

Sobrecargas

Name Description
GetCustomAttributes(Boolean)

Devolve todos os atributos personalizados definidos para este tipo.

GetCustomAttributes(Type, Boolean)

Devolve todos os atributos personalizados do tipo atual que podem ser atribuídos a um tipo especificado.

GetCustomAttributes(Boolean)

Devolve todos os atributos personalizados definidos para este tipo.

public:
 override cli::array <System::Object ^> ^ GetCustomAttributes(bool inherit);
public override object[] GetCustomAttributes(bool inherit);
override this.GetCustomAttributes : bool -> obj[]
Public Overrides Function GetCustomAttributes (inherit As Boolean) As Object()

Parâmetros

inherit
Boolean

Especifica se deve pesquisar a cadeia de herança deste membro para encontrar os atributos.

Devoluções

Object[]

Devolve um array de objetos que representam todos os atributos personalizados deste tipo.

Exceções

Este método não é atualmente suportado para tipos incompletos. Recupere o tipo usando GetType() e chame GetCustomAttributes(Boolean) no retorno Type.

Aplica-se a

GetCustomAttributes(Type, Boolean)

Devolve todos os atributos personalizados do tipo atual que podem ser atribuídos a um tipo especificado.

public:
 override cli::array <System::Object ^> ^ GetCustomAttributes(Type ^ attributeType, bool inherit);
public override object[] GetCustomAttributes(Type attributeType, bool inherit);
override this.GetCustomAttributes : Type * bool -> obj[]
Public Overrides Function GetCustomAttributes (attributeType As Type, inherit As Boolean) As Object()

Parâmetros

attributeType
Type

O tipo de atributo a procurar. Apenas os atributos que podem ser atribuídos a este tipo são devolvidos.

inherit
Boolean

Especifica se deve pesquisar a cadeia de herança deste membro para encontrar os atributos.

Devoluções

Object[]

Um array de atributos personalizados definidos no tipo atual.

Exceções

Este método não é atualmente suportado para tipos incompletos. Recupere o tipo usando GetType() e chame GetCustomAttributes(Boolean) no retorno Type.

attributeType é null.

O tipo deve ser um tipo fornecido pelo sistema de execução subjacente.

Aplica-se a